diff options
author | arunvoddu <arunvoddu@google.com> | 2023-03-30 11:02:44 +0000 |
---|---|---|
committer | arunvoddu <arunvoddu@google.com> | 2023-04-04 03:37:49 +0000 |
commit | 3ea803cb35a1d73e29e5bd993595431e3ec28a3e (patch) | |
tree | 5ec3f16a8c24d7964ef67e8d37130198fad41a85 /src/java/com/android/internal/telephony/uicc | |
parent | 32f2c07ae4859f67a1525bff7ecb9bcceac9e72f (diff) | |
download | telephony-3ea803cb35a1d73e29e5bd993595431e3ec28a3e.tar.gz |
Adding extra flag while broadcasting the SIM_STATE_CHANGED
Bug: 275646028
Test: atest verified
Change-Id: I9f8fdc18373cfb0a32da03c362dde0567242c318
Diffstat (limited to 'src/java/com/android/internal/telephony/uicc')
-rw-r--r-- | src/java/com/android/internal/telephony/uicc/UiccController.java |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/java/com/android/internal/telephony/uicc/UiccController.java b/src/java/com/android/internal/telephony/uicc/UiccController.java index 94d5d3bef8..051cdfa537 100644 --- a/src/java/com/android/internal/telephony/uicc/UiccController.java +++ b/src/java/com/android/internal/telephony/uicc/UiccController.java @@ -806,6 +806,7 @@ public class UiccController extends Handler { // DO NOT add any new extras to this broadcast -- it is not protected by any permissions. Intent intent = new Intent(TelephonyIntents.ACTION_SIM_STATE_CHANGED); intent.addFlags(Intent.FLAG_RECEIVER_REGISTERED_ONLY_BEFORE_BOOT); + intent.addFlags(Intent.FLAG_RECEIVER_FOREGROUND); intent.putExtra(PhoneConstants.PHONE_NAME_KEY, "Phone"); intent.putExtra(IccCardConstants.INTENT_KEY_ICC_STATE, state); intent.putExtra(IccCardConstants.INTENT_KEY_LOCKED_REASON, reason); |